James, Cavs look to build on success vs. Nets

Dec 14, 2007 - 3:45 PM Cleveland (10-12) at New Jersey (9-13) 8:00 pm EST

EAST RUTHERFORD, New Jersey (Ticker) - Superstar LeBron James looks to return to the starting lineup as the Cleveland Cavaliers visit the New Jersey Nets.

James came back after spending the last five games in street clothes with a sprained left index fingers to help the Cavs end their six-game slide with Tuesday's 118-105 victory over Indiana.

"That was one and done for me," James said about coming off the bench for the first time in his career. "I will not be coming off the bench anymore."

Wearing a protective padded glove on his hand, James scored 17 points in 22 minutes. The 23-year-old All-Star leads the league in scoring at 29.9 points.

Cleveland big man Anderson Varejao made his season debut in the win after ending his contract holdout a week ago by inking a three-year, $17 million deal.

The Nets dropped their fourth straight game with Tuesday's 91-82 setback at the hands of the Los Angeles Clippers despite another triple-double by Jason Kidd.

"This is a veteran ballclub and we've just got to stay together. Fits have already been thrown," Kidd said. "We're trying to find a way, trying to find anything to get us going in the right direction."

New Jersey might enjoy facing Cleveland, which has lost the past three meetings - including an impressive 100-79 defeat earlier this month.
